Abstract

The utility model discloses a folding bicycle. The upper end of a rear fork assembly and the upper end of a front fork assembly are connected through a connecting rod. The connecting rod comprises a positioning part and a movable rod. One end of the positioning part and one end of the movable rod are connected in a rotating mode through a hinge pin. The upper end of the rear fork assembly is movably connected to the connecting rod in a sleeved mode, and the other end of the positioning part and the other end of the movable rod are respectively provided with a limiting structure for limiting slippage of the rear fork assembly. The positioning part is connected with the front fork assembly in a rotating mode, and the axis of the part, for sliding of the rear fork assembly, on the positioning part is parallel to the axis of a rear wheel. When the folding bicycle is in the unfolded state, the structure is stable, when the folding bicycle is folded, the front fork assembly and the rear fork assembly can be pulled away in the transverse direction, then the front fork assembly is rotated to be roughly flush with the rear fork assembly to form a support, a beam assembly is drawn towards the rear fork assembly, and two wheels are drawn to be parallel to support the support. Folding is achieved and is convenient, the folding bicycle can be used as a small trailer after being folded and can be used for shopping and dragging luggage.
